Google Introduces TimesFM-3 Forecasting Model

Google introduced TimesFM-3 as its latest time series model. The release adds zero-shot multivariate forecasting capabilities to the family. Reports state the model tops rival benchmarks. The same reports note that the new version drops the open license used in earlier iterations. A post from The New Stack states that users cannot apply the model at work yet. No further details on availability or licensing terms appear in the supplied posts. The account frames the update as a performance gain paired with restricted access.
